ORG Packaging, one of the largest canmakers in China, is increasing its capacity to supply Red Bull with cans from a new three-piece canmaking line being installed this year.
ORG Packaging, one of the largest canmakers in China, is increasing its capacity to supply Red Bull with cans from a new three-piece canmaking line being installed this year.